Key Cost Factors

Building raising is a process used to elevate structures in Columbus, GA, often to protect against flooding or to accommodate foundation repairs. The scope and complexity of raising a building can vary based on several factors, including materials, size, and local permitting requirements. Understanding typical project considerations can help in planning and budgeting for a building raising project.

  • Materials: Common materials include wood, concrete, and steel supports, selected based on the building’s existing structure and the desired elevation.
  • Size and Scope: Projects can range from small residential homes to larger commercial buildings, affecting the overall complexity and duration.
  • Labor Complexity: The process involves careful planning, structural analysis, and precise lifting techniques, often requiring specialized labor skills.
  • Permitting: Local regulations in Columbus, GA, typically require permits for building raising, which may include inspections and adherence to building codes.
  • Extras: Additional considerations may include foundation repairs, utility disconnects and reconnects, and site restoration after the lift.
